Meaning of "Icebox" by Nada Surf


The lyrics of "Icebox" by Nada Surf seem to convey a deep emotional journey of coming to terms with mortality and the importance of relationships. The narrator seems to be grappling with the regrets of wasted time and missed opportunities to express feelings towards someone. Despite recognizing their own mortality, they are still fixated on the idea of holding onto those emotions even after death. The conflicting emotions of sorrow and joy suggest a complex understanding of life and death, hinting at a desire for closure and peace in the face of impending mortality. The repeated plea to be buried in sorrow and covered in joy might signify a need to embrace both the pain and happiness that life has to offer, as well as a desire for a meaningful connection that transcends physical boundaries. Overall, the lyrics delve into themes of introspection, regret, acceptance, and the enduring power of emotions even in the face of death.
